Local anaethsetic … WebPICC line? y You could get an infection. y You could get a blood clot. y Your line could block or stop working. y Your line could move out of position. Infection: If the site becomes hot, red, swollen or painful, or you feel unwell, tell your nurse or doctor as soon as possible. Blood clots: These can form around your line in your vein.

Removing the PICC line is quick and, while uncomfortable, should … Web28 sep. 2024 · Irritation of the heart: If the line is too close to the heart, or in the heart, it can irritate the heart and cause a cardiac arrhythmia, an abnormal heart rhythm. If the problem is not diagnosed quickly, the PICC line rubbing against the beating heart can cause damage to the heart muscle or valves. The PICC nurse will use an ultrasound machine to locate the best vein in your arm to place the PICC line. This will not hurt. Does it hurt having a PICC line put in? Can a nurse insert a PICC line? WebThe nurse sutures (stitches) the PICC line in place and covers the site with a sterile bandage. An x-ray is done to make sure that the catheter is in the right place. It takes 1 – 1.5 hours to place the PICC line. Most patients feel little or no discomfort during this procedure. A local anesthetic may be used.

WebWhat are the benefits of having a PICC line? A PICC can be used to give chemotherapy, anti-cancer drugs, fluids, antibiotics and other drugs directly into the vein . It can also be used for taking blood samples . PICC lines are inserted when a central line is needed for short term use . Removal of a PICC line is quick and typically painless. The sutures holding the line in the appropriate place are removed, and the line is gently pulled from the arm. Most patients say that it feels strange to have it removed, but it is not uncomfortable or painful. ctrl shift t 使えない
